DESCRIPTION

A perfectly matched and flawlessly sounding five speaker system, the SXHTB+ has the best of both worlds. With high reproduction qualities in music as well as surround sound home theater, this system is perfect in any application. When the SXHTB+ is used in Dolby surround and DTS systems you can truly experience what home cinema is supposed to be. Plus, this system can easily be integrated with an active subwoofer for a true low frequency effect.

Strength:

The Towers are really quite amazing. I agree with the past posts about breaking them in. They're very poppy and the tweaters are a little shreaking. After about 10 hours of listening, I started to hear them smooth out a bit. There is a nice full range sound coming from these. I disagree with the other reviews about the bass. There isn't floor shaking bass (like from a subwoofer) but the bass that is there is tight, clean and precise. I don't wish for anymore bass from these. I think too much bass distorts the natural sound of the recording (funny thing, I'm a bass player in a Jazz group). The center channel can be noticed as a little flat at times. During movies, the dialog comes through clear and rich, but they are out performed by the towers. The rear speakers are very similar to the center. They both share the same frequency response and drivers. These are very pretty speakers as well. They do have a vinyl covering on the pressboard but they look very nice at any distance. Besides the feel, you wouldn't know they were covered. They are also heavy. All of the speakers are very solid. The mains come with floor spikes which are great for stability alone.

Weakness:

I wish the center and rears had a bit more range. That would make this package perfect. The vinyl is also something I'd replace if possible, but that's why they're so affordable I guess (they ARE prettier than alot of big name speakers though). $50 shipping!

I've been wanting to upgrade my home theater setup for some time now. I had been reading up on affordable speakers systems and was pretty set on the Cambridge movieworks 108. After reading about the Fluance SX-HTB I started to get curious. I gave it a chance and they're better than I expected.

I purchased these after checking out a number of more expensive, "mainstream" systems. Reading the raves on avsforums.com, I decided to take the plunge. I am definitely not disappointed. The packaging is sturdy. Very pretty speakers. What the other reviewers have said about the towers is correct; they are _awesome_. The centers and satellites hold up quite well, though. It's not that they're bad -- far from it -- they're just somewhat outclassed by the towers. The only noticable weakness is that the bass is somewhat boomy. The towers come with bi-wiring capability, though I haven't tried that yet; bi-wiring may cut down on that. Nevertheless, adding an old subwoofer I had remedied the problem easily.
